We offer: Medical/Dental/Vision Benefits on your FIRST DAY!!! competitive wages great work atmosphere Minimum Education: High School Diploma level of education Experience: Required: At least one (1) year of experience within Sterile Processing IAHCSMM or CBSPD Certification required within six months of hire. Preferred: At least three (3) years of experience within Sterile Processing At least one (1) of Leadership experience, highly preferred The Surgical Reprocessing Tech Lead coordinates workflow and assists with staff supervision, orientation and assignment of duties within the surgical reprocessing department. Monitors instrument processing and sterilization for quality assurance. Complete staff performance reviews, issue corrective actions, warnings, and monitor department purchasing when delegated by department manager.
